AS A RESULT, STMICROELECTRONICS SHALL NOT BE HELD LIABLE FOR ANY DIRECT, INDIRECT OR CONSEQUENTIAL DAMAGES WITH RESPECT TO ANY CLAIMS ARISING FROM THE CONTENT OF SUCH SOFTWARE AND/OR THE USE MADE BY CUSTOMERS OF THE CODING INFORMATION CONTAINED HEREIN IN CONNECTION WITH THEIR PRODUCTS. ********************************************************************************** Example description =================== This example demontrates the use of the Enhanced Interrupt Controller (EIC): - Configuration of 8 TIM (TIM0..TIM7)timers to generate an interrupt on each counter overflow event. - TIM0 is linked to the first fast FIQ channel while all others timers to their correspondant IRQ channel. - Assignment of a descendant IRQ priority for each IRQ channel : TIM1 has a priority of 7 and TIM7 has a priority of 1. - In each interrupt routine, a pin of GPIO4 is chosen to toggle the IRQ or FIQ (entry/exit) status. The system clock(MCLK) is using the internal oscillator ~ 1.17MHz. The prescaler of each timer is equal to the timer number. For example, TIM7 has a prescaler = 7 .
